Start your day with a visit to Dubai Marina, a picturesque waterfront development that offers stunning views of the city's modern skyline. Take a leisurely walk along the promenade, or relax at one of the many cafes while enjoying the calming atmosphere. Cost: Free. Time spent: 2 hours.
Head over to Jumeirah Beach, one of Dubai's most popular beaches. Bask in the sun, swim in the crystal-clear waters, or simply unwind on the soft sandy shores. There are also beachfront cafes where you can grab a refreshing drink or a light snack. Cost: Free. Time spent: 3 hours.
Escape the sun and indulge in some retail therapy at Dubai Mall, the world's largest shopping mall. Explore the vast array of shops, from luxury brands to local boutiques, and take a stroll through the stunning indoor aquarium. Don't miss the mesmerizing Dubai Fountain show just outside the mall. Cost: Varies (shopping). Time spent: 3 hours.
Visit Dubai Miracle Garden, a botanical paradise filled with vibrant floral displays. Take a peaceful stroll through the well-manicured gardens, admire the stunning flower arrangements, and capture memorable photos amidst the colorful blooms. Cost: AED 55 (approx. $15) per person. Time spent: 2 hours.
End your day with a relaxing cruise along Dubai Creek, an ancient waterway that divides the city into two main sections. Enjoy a traditional Arabian dinner aboard a dhow (traditional wooden boat) as you take in the enchanting views of the city's skyline illuminated at night. Cost: AED 150 (approx. $41) per person. Time spent: 2 hours.
For a truly relaxing experience, consider visiting The Ritz-Carlton Spa, JBR. This luxurious spa offers a range of treatments and massages to help you unwind and rejuvenate. Another local favorite is the Al Mamzar Beach Park, a tranquil and less crowded beach where you can enjoy the serene surroundings and have a picnic with family or friends.
